Ryan W. Holloway is a scholar working on Molecular Biology, Water Science and Technology and Biomedical Engineering. According to data from OpenAlex, Ryan W. Holloway has authored 21 papers receiving a total of 2.0k indexed citations (citations by other indexed papers that have themselves been cited), including 9 papers in Molecular Biology, 8 papers in Water Science and Technology and 7 papers in Biomedical Engineering. Recurrent topics in Ryan W. Holloway's work include Membrane Separation Technologies (8 papers), Membrane-based Ion Separation Techniques (7 papers) and Wastewater Treatment and Nitrogen Removal (4 papers). Ryan W. Holloway is often cited by papers focused on Membrane Separation Technologies (8 papers), Membrane-based Ion Separation Techniques (7 papers) and Wastewater Treatment and Nitrogen Removal (4 papers). Ryan W. Holloway collaborates with scholars based in United States, Canada and Australia. Ryan W. Holloway's co-authors include Tzahi Y. Cath, Amy E. Childress, Keith E. Dennett, Alamelu G. Bharadwaj, David M. Waisman, Amanda S. Hering, Kathryn B. Newhart, Moamen Bydoun, Andrea Achilli and Julia Regnery and has published in prestigious journals such as Journal of Biological Chemistry, Environmental Science & Technology and Water Research.

All Works

20 of 20 papers shown
1.
Bharadwaj, Alamelu G., Ryan W. Holloway, Victoria A. Miller, & David M. Waisman. (2021). Plasmin and Plasminogen System in the Tumor Microenvironment: Implications for Cancer Diagnosis, Prognosis, and Therapy. Cancers. 13(8). 1838–1838. 81 indexed citations
2.
Holloway, Ryan W. & Paola A. Marignani. (2021). Targeting mTOR and Glycolysis in HER2-Positive Breast Cancer. Cancers. 13(12). 2922–2922. 37 indexed citations
3.
Cruickshank, Brianne M., Cheryl A. Dean, Ryan W. Holloway, et al.. (2020). Decitabine Response in Breast Cancer Requires Efficient Drug Processing and Is Not Limited by Multidrug Resistance. Molecular Cancer Therapeutics. 19(5). 1110–1122. 20 indexed citations
4.
Bharadwaj, Alamelu G., Rong‐Zong Liu, Lynn N. Thomas, et al.. (2020). S100A10 Has a Critical Regulatory Function in Mammary Tumor Growth and Metastasis: Insights Using MMTV-PyMT Oncomice and Clinical Patient Sample Analysis. Cancers. 12(12). 3673–3673. 11 indexed citations
5.
Holloway, Ryan W., et al.. (2020). Enhancement of activated sludge wastewater treatment with hydraulic selection. Separation and Purification Technology. 250. 117214–117214. 15 indexed citations
6.
Sultan, Mohammad, Dejan Vidovic, Cheryl A. Dean, et al.. (2019). Retinoic acid and arsenic trioxide induce lasting differentiation and demethylation of target genes in APL cells. Scientific Reports. 9(1). 9414–9414. 29 indexed citations
7.
Newhart, Kathryn B., Ryan W. Holloway, Amanda S. Hering, & Tzahi Y. Cath. (2019). Data-driven performance analyses of wastewater treatment plants: A review. Water Research. 157. 498–513. 321 indexed citations breakdown →
8.
Holloway, Ryan W., Margaret L. Thomas, Alejandro Cohen, et al.. (2018). Regulation of cell surface protease receptor S100A10 by retinoic acid therapy in acute promyelocytic leukemia (APL)☆. Cell Death and Disease. 9(9). 920–920. 14 indexed citations
9.
Holloway, Ryan W., et al.. (2016). Life-cycle assessment of two potable water reuse technologies: MF/RO/UV–AOP treatment and hybrid osmotic membrane bioreactors. Journal of Membrane Science. 507. 165–178. 91 indexed citations
10.
Holloway, Ryan W., et al.. (2016). Comparison of linear and nonlinear dimension reduction techniques for automated process monitoring of a decentralized wastewater treatment facility. Stochastic Environmental Research and Risk Assessment. 30(5). 1527–1544. 32 indexed citations
11.
Vuono, David C., Julia Regnery, Dong Li, et al.. (2016). rRNA Gene Expression of Abundant and Rare Activated-Sludge Microorganisms and Growth Rate Induced Micropollutant Removal. Environmental Science & Technology. 50(12). 6299–6309. 49 indexed citations
12.
Cath, Tzahi Y., et al.. (2016). Long-term Piloting Of Osmotic MBR For Potable Reuse: Performance, Life-Cycle Assessment, and Lessons Learned. Proceedings of the Water Environment Federation. 2016(14). 830–854. 1 indexed citations
13.
Bell, Elizabeth, Ryan W. Holloway, & Tzahi Y. Cath. (2016). Evaluation of forward osmosis membrane performance and fouling during long-term osmotic membrane bioreactor study. Journal of Membrane Science. 517. 1–13. 63 indexed citations
14.
Holloway, Ryan W., et al.. (2015). Impact of virus surface characteristics on removal mechanisms within membrane bioreactors. Water Research. 84. 144–152. 45 indexed citations
15.
Holloway, Ryan W., et al.. (2015). Mixed draw solutions for improved forward osmosis performance. Journal of Membrane Science. 491. 121–131. 75 indexed citations
16.
Holloway, Ryan W., Andrea Achilli, & Tzahi Y. Cath. (2015). The osmotic membrane bioreactor: a critical review. Environmental Science Water Research & Technology. 1(5). 581–605. 114 indexed citations
17.
Holloway, Ryan W., Julia Regnery, Long D. Nghiem, & Tzahi Y. Cath. (2014). Removal of Trace Organic Chemicals and Performance of a Novel Hybrid Ultrafiltration-Osmotic Membrane Bioreactor. Environmental Science & Technology. 48(18). 10859–10868. 118 indexed citations
18.
Bharadwaj, Alamelu G., Moamen Bydoun, Ryan W. Holloway, & David M. Waisman. (2013). Annexin A2 Heterotetramer: Structure and Function. International Journal of Molecular Sciences. 14(3). 6259–6305. 246 indexed citations
19.
Holloway, Ryan W., Oleg Bogachev, Alamelu G. Bharadwaj, et al.. (2012). Stromal Adipocyte Enhancer-binding Protein (AEBP1) Promotes Mammary Epithelial Cell Hyperplasia via Proinflammatory and Hedgehog Signaling. Journal of Biological Chemistry. 287(46). 39171–39181. 34 indexed citations
20.
Holloway, Ryan W., Amy E. Childress, Keith E. Dennett, & Tzahi Y. Cath. (2007). Forward osmosis for concentration of anaerobic digester centrate. Water Research. 41(17). 4005–4014. 467 indexed citations breakdown →
